Write an equation in point-slope form of the line that passes through the point (4 - 5) and has a slope of 2.

Respuesta :

salwabaki0017 salwabaki0017
  • 22-12-2020

Answer:

y=2x-13

Step-by-step explanation:

According to y- y1= m( x-x1),

y-(-5)= 2 ( x-4)

So, y=2x -13
